1. Introduction to Cryptocurrency Wallets

Cryptocurrency wallets are digital wallets used to store, send, and receive digital currenc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in. These wallets act as a personal bank account for cryptocurrencies, allowing users to securely manage their digital assets.

2. Types of Cryptocurrency Wallets

a. Hardware Wallets: These wallets store cryptocurrencies offline, providing enhanced security. They are considered one of the safest options for storing large amounts of cryptocurrencies.

b. Software Wallets: These wallets are installed on a computer or smartphone and can be accessed online. They are suitable for storing smaller amounts of cryptocurrencies.

c. Mobile Wallets: These wallets are available as mobile applications and can be used on smartphones. They offer convenience but may be less secure than hardware wallets.

5. Top Cryptocurrency Wallets

a. Ledger Nano S: This hardware wallet is one of the most popular options due to its high security and compatibility with over 1,200 cryptocurrencies.

b. Trezor Model T: Another popular hardware wallet, the Trezor Model T offers a touchscreen interface and supports over 1,500 cryptocurrencies.

c. Exodus: This software wallet is known for its user-friendly interface and supports over 200 cryptocurrencies.

9. FAQs about Cryptocurrency Wallets

Q1: What is the best cryptocurrency wallet?

A1: The best cryptocurrency wallet depends on your individual needs, such as security, ease of use, and the cryptocurrencies you want to store.

Q2: Can a cryptocurrency wallet be hacked?

A2: Yes, cryptocurrency wallets can be hacked, especially if they lack strong security features.

Q3: How do I backup my cryptocurrency wallet?

A3: Most wallets allow you to generate a backup phrase or mnemonic seed. Store this phrase in a secure location, such as a password manager or a physical copy.

Q4: Can I use a cryptocurrency wallet to store fiat currency?

A4: No, cryptocurrency wallets are designed to store digital currenc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in.

Q5: What is a private key in a cryptocurrency wallet?

A5: A private key is a unique code that allows you to access and control your cryptocurrencies. Keep it secure to prevent unauthorized access.

Q6: Can I transfer cryptocurrencies from one wallet to another?

A6: Yes, you can transfer cryptocurrencies from one wallet to another using their public addresses.

Q7: How do I recover my cryptocurrency wallet?

A7: If you lose access to your cryptocurrency wallet, you can recover it using your backup phrase or mnemonic seed.
